What is ABB EV-to-EBITDA?

ABB MEX:ABB N 85 EV-to-EBITDA is 9.19 as of Aug. 11, 2026, which is 47% below its 10-year median of 17.29. GuruFocus rates MEX:ABB N with a GF Score™ of 85/100 and a GF Value™ of MXN423.90. The stock has 4 warning signs investors should review. Among 2,475 Industrial Products companies, ABB ranks worse than 65.58% on this metric.

EV-to-EBITDA is calculated as enterprise value divided by its EBITDA. As of today, ABB's enterprise value is MXN1,263,768 Mil. ABB's EBITDA for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Jun. 2026 was MXN137,525 Mil. Therefore, ABB's EV-to-EBITDA for today is 9.19.

EV-to-EBITDA is a valuation multiple used in finance and investment to measure the value of a company. This important multiple is often used in conjunction with, or as an alternative to, the PE Ratio to determine the fair market value of a company.

As of today (2026-08-11), ABB's stock price is MXN663.00. ABB's Earnings per Share (Diluted) for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Jun. 2026 was MXN49.636. Therefore, ABB's PE Ratio (TTM) for today is 13.36.

The "classic" EV-to-EBITDA is much better in capturing debt and net cash than the PE Ratio (TTM).

ABB Business Description

Address Affolternstrasse 44, Zurich, CHE, 8050
ABB supplies electrical equipment and automation products. Founded in the late 19th century, the company was created out of the merger of two old industrial companies: ASEA and BBC. Its products include electrical equipment, industrial robots, and equipment used for industrial automation, sold via approximately 19 business divisions. ABB is the number-one or number-two supplier in two-thirds of its product segments.
